Kornilov and Vassiliev new Russian Champions

The Russian National Championships of ladies and men were held in Chaikowsky last week.

Denis Kornilov won the competition on the normal hill with jumps on 105.5 m and 96 m and 254.0 points. With the best performance in the second round, Dimitry Vassiliev moved up from fifth to second (99 m and 102.5 m; 249.5 points). The third place on the podium went to Alexander Bazhenov with 101 m and 98.5 m (247.0 points).

On the large hill, Dimitry Vassiliev was fourth after the first round with 129.5 m, the longest jump of the day on 136 m then earned the veteran the title with a total of 243.9 points. The second place went to Roman Trofimov with 126.5 m and 131 m and 242.5 points, Evgeniy Klimov, who was in the lead ahead of Trofimov and Pachin after the first round, came in third with 127.5 m and 125.5 m (235.9 points).

The ladies' competition was won by Sofya Tikhonova with 100.5 m and 94 m (236.5 points), ahead of Irina Avvakumova (96.5 m and 95.5 m; 231.5 points) and Anastasiya Gladysheva (83 m and 94.5 m; 195.5 points).

Top 10 Russian Championships, Chaikowsky HS 106; March 27th, 2015

Rank Name Distance Points
1. Kornilov, Denis 105.5 m - 96 m 254.0
2. Vassiliev, Dimitry 99 m - 102.5 m 249.5
3. Bazhenov, Alexander 101 m - 98.5 m 247.0
4. Maksimochkin, Mikhail 102 m - 96.5 m 245.5
5. Kalinitschenko, Anton 98 m - 99.5 m 243.0
6. Trofimov, Roman 106 m - 89 m 238.5
7. Usachev, Egor 93.5 m - 99 m 231.0
8. Sardyko, Alexander 97.5 m - 92 m 225.5
9. Boyarintsev, Vladislav 89.5 m - 100 m 224.5
10. Hazetdinov, Ilmir 98 m - 91.5 m 223.5

Top 10 Russian Championships, Chaikowsky HS 140; March 30th, 2015

Rank Name Distance Points
1. Vassiliev, Dimitry 129.5 m - 136 m 243.9
2. Trofimov, Roman 126.5 m - 131 m 242.5
3. Klimov, Evegniy 127.5 m - 125.5 m 235.9
4. Kalinitschenko, Anton 126.5 m - 128.5 m 229.5
5. Pachin, Andrey 126.5 m - 117.5 m 214.2
6. Maksimochkin, Mikhail 115.5 m - 130.5 m 212.3
7. Kornilov, Denis 121 m - 119 m 207.0
8. Boyarintsev, Vladislav 119 m - 118.5 m 202.5
9. Shuvalov, Alexander 120 m - 119 m 202.2
10. Hazetdinov, Ilmir 119 m - 118 m 198.6
